A Phase 2b open-label, single-arm study to evaluate pharmacokinetics, efficacy, safety and tolerability of letermovir in pediatric participants from birth to less than 18 years of age at risk of developing CMV infection and/or disease following allogeneic haematopoietic stem cell transplantation (HSCT)

入选标准

  • 1. All Age Group 1 participants must have documented positive CMV serostatus (CMV IgG seropositive) for the recipient (R+). Participants in Age Group 2 and 3 must have documented positive CMV serostatus (CMV IgG seropositive) for the recipient (R+) and/or the donor (D+) and the time of screening.
  • 2. Be the recipient of a first allogeneic HSCT (bone marrow, peripheral blood stem cell, or cord blood transplant).
  • 3. Have undetectable CMV DNA from a plasma or whole blood sample collected within 5 days prior to enrollment.
  • 4. Be within 28 days post-HSCT at the time of enrollment.
  • 5. Participant is aged from birth to <18 years of age at the time of signing the informed consent/assent.
  • 6. A female participant is eligible to participate if she is not pregnant (Appendix 5), not breastfeeding, and at least 1 of the following conditions applies:
  • a. Not a woman of childbearing potential (WOCBP) as defined in the protocol.
  • b. A WOCBP who agrees to follow the contraceptive guidance in the protocol during the treatment period and for at least 28 days after the last dose of study intervention.
  • 7. The participant’s legally acceptable representative(s) provides written informed consent for the study and, when applicable, the participant provides written informed assent. The participant’s legally acceptable representative(s) may also provide consent for Future Biomedical Research (FBR); however, the participant may participate in the main study without participating in FBR.
  • 8. Study participants in Panel A of Age Groups 1 and 2 must be able to take (as assessed by the investigator) LET tablets or the oral granules (either by mouth or via G tube/NG tube), provided the participant does not have a condition

排除标准

  • 1. Received a previous allogeneic HSCT (Receipt of a previous autologous HSCT acceptable).
  • 2. History of CMV end-organ disease within 6 months prior to enrollment.
  • 3. Evidence of CMV viremia at any time from either signing of ICF or HSCT procedure, whichever is earlier, until time of enrollment.
  • 4. Suspected or known hypersensitivity to active or inactive ingredients of LET formulations.
  • 5. Severe hepatic insufficiency (defined as Child-Pugh Class C) within 5 days prior to enrollment.
  • 6. Serum aspartate aminotransferase (AST) or alanine aminotransferase (ALT) >5 x the upper limit of normal (ULN) or serum total bilirubin >2.5 x ULN within 5 days prior to enrollment.
  • 7. Is on hemodialysis or has end-stage renal impairment with a creatinine clearance =10 mL/min, as calculated by the Cockcroft-Gault equation (participants =12 years of age) or =10 mL/min/1.73 m2 by the modified Schwartz equation (participants <12 years of age) using serum creatinine within 5 days prior to enrollment.
  • 8. Has both moderate hepatic insufficiency AND moderate-to-severe renal insufficiency.
  • 9. Uncontrolled infection on the day of enrollment.
  • 10. Requires mechanical ventilation or is hemodynamically unstable at the time of enrollment.
  • 11. Has a documented positive result for a HIVAb test at any time prior to enrollment, or for hepatitis C virus antibody (HCV-Ab) with detectable HCV RNA, or h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g) within 90 days prior to enrollment.
  • 12. Active solid tumor malignancies with the exception of localized basal cell or squamous cell skin cancer or the condition under treatment (eg, lymphomas).
  • 13. Preexisting cardiac condition a) for which the patient is currently being treated or b) which required hospitalization within the last 6 months or c) that may be expected to recur during the course of the trial. Examples of preexisting cardiac conditions that would preclude enrollment include atrial fibrillation and atrial flutter.
  • 14. Received within 7 days prior to screening any of the following - ganciclovir, valganciclovir, foscarnet, acyclovir (at doses greater than those recommended for HSV/VZV prophylaxis), valacyclovir (at doses greater than those recommended for HSV/VZV prophylaxis), famciclovir
  • 15. Received within 30 days prior to screening of any of the following:
  • - cidofovir
  • - CMV immunoglobulin
  • - any investigational CMV antiviral agent/biologic therapy
  • - Rifampin and other strong inducers (such as phenytoin, carbamazepine, St John’s wort (Hypericum perforatum), rifabutin and phenobarbital) and moderate inducers such as nafcillin, thioridazine, modafinil and bosentan.
  • 16. Received letermovir at any time prior to enrollment in this study.
  • 17. Is currently participating or has participated in a study with an unapproved investigational compound or device within 28 days, or 5X half-life of the investigational compound (excluding monoclonal antibodies), whichever is longer, of initial dosing in this study. Participants previously treated with a monoclonal antibody will be eligible to participate after a 28-day washout period.
  • 18. Previously participated in this study or any other study involving LET.
  • 19. Previously participated or is currently participating in any study involving administration of a CMV vaccine or another CMV investigational agent, or is planning to participate in a study of a CMV vaccine or another CMV investigational agent during the course of this study.
